What is it?
What is it?Would you like a simple and safe way to consult medical results and data? That may be done using our portal website www.cozo.be or the accompanying app (to be used on smartphone or tablet). This provides patients with a user-friendly way to access to their own medical records.
Patients who have consulted a physician at our hospital or at our Maria Middelares Medical Centre in Ghent-Bruges or at our Medical Centre in Aalter can consult their data digitally from three weeks after validation by their physician. This will allow physicians enough time to first discuss the results with the patients and give them an interpretation of the data.
It is easy to consult your data from various care providers (reports, results, imaging, medication plans, letters...) from a single source..
Note: only data from 01 December 2017 or after is available. Do you need information that is from before that date? Request information from (the secretariat for) your attending physician.

CoZo?
CoZo?Our hospital is part of the Cooperative Care Platform (CoZo), a digital cooperation platform that allows patients, care providers and facilities to exchange medical data. It is the federal government's largest data sharing network within eHealth. Data from more than 110 facilities and data sources (including hospitals, psychiatric facilities, laboratories, radiology practices and regional vaults Vitalink, BruSafe and Intermed) can now be consulted centrally and securely through the CoZo platform. Given the sensitivity of the data, the security of the registration and login procedure is paramount.
